Lines Matching refs:uap
73 struct mounta *uap; in mount() local
80 uap = &native; in mount()
81 uap->spec = (char *)*lp++; in mount()
82 uap->dir = (char *)*lp++; in mount()
83 uap->flags = (int)*lp++; in mount()
84 uap->fstype = (char *)*lp++; in mount()
85 uap->dataptr = (char *)*lp++; in mount()
86 uap->datalen = (int)*lp++; in mount()
87 uap->optptr = (char *)*lp++; in mount()
88 uap->optlen = (int)*lp++; in mount()
94 uap = (struct mounta *)lp; in mount()
99 if (error = lookupname(uap->dir, UIO_USERSPACE, FOLLOW, NULLVPP, &vp)) in mount()
105 uap->flags &= MS_MASK; in mount()
107 if ((vp->v_flag & VPXFS) && ((uap->flags & MS_GLOBAL) != MS_GLOBAL)) { in mount()
114 } else if (uap->flags & MS_GLOBAL) { in mount()
125 error = domount("pxfs", uap, vp, CRED(), &vfsp); in mount()
130 error = domount(NULL, uap, vp, CRED(), &vfsp); in mount()